In January 2010, Ardent acquired seven of Zest's Western Australian health clubs for $4.2 million in cash and stock. The locations were rebranded to Goodlife Health Clubs. [7] In August 2016, Ardent sold the 76-club Goodlife business to Quadrant Private Equity for $260 million, forming part of its Fitness and Lifestyle Group. [8] [9]
Epping is an industrial area of Cape Town that is situated to the south of Thornton, east of Pinelands and north of Langa. Epping Industria was first developed in the late 1940s. Industrial development was initially slow and in the early 1950s the circular Gunners Circle was used as a race track for cars.

Periodization refers to the organization of training into sequential phases and cyclical periods, and the change in training over time. The simplest strength training periodization involves keeping a fixed schedule of sets and reps (e.g. 2 sets of 12 reps of bicep curls every 2 days), and steadily increasing the intensity on a weekly basis.
During this exercise the spotter will assist in “lifting off” the bar from the racked position. Then the spotter will keep his/her hands about 6 inches under the bar. This allows the spotter to assist when the lifter runs out of energy, but most importantly allows the spotter to catch the weight if the lifter cannot lift any more.
Snap Fitness is a privately-owned global chain of 24/7 fitness centers headquartered in Chanhassen, Minnesota, United States. It was founded in 2003 by Peter Taunton and currently operates over 1,000 locations in over 20 countries across 5 continents, with over half a million members.
